WHAT’S UP TODAY

First up this morning in your Miami Hurricanes news?

While Miami has added portal firepower, so have the Canes’ opponents … and we look at the top 10 transfer opponents UM will be facing.

There’s a new Message Board Mania series to check out, this one with fans sharing their favorite game from last year. Some of the posters’ thoughts might just surprise you.

Our game by game previews also resume as we take in-depth looks at what Miami will be facing. So you can go ahead and check out what Miami is facing in NC State, Syracuse and a huge game at SMU.

We also are continue our July Player Performance Index series looking at the 30 most impactful players for the coming season. In this series we focus in on how productive we think each Miami player will be this coming season. Today you can check out our in-depth looks at No. 20 Ryan Rodriguez, No. 19 Keionte Scott and No. 18 Jordan Lyle. All three are going to be key players on this team.

In recruiting our coverage starts with a comprehensive notebook on Miami targets from the Crib Classic.

There’s an update with massive RB priority Derrek Cooper as he hones in on a July 20 decision date.

Another update is with top-15 2027 CB and Miami commit Kenton Dopson, who updates the status of his plans to reclassify to this year’s class.

We have your stock watch looking at Miami commits we think will trend up in their rankings this coming season.

We also catch up with 2028 Miami target Steven Moore for his ultra-early thoughts on the Canes.

Find out about a new DT offer as well and what Concord (Calif.) De La Salle three-star Cal defensive tackle commit Nemyah Telona is saying about it.
